Rishabh Pant's Frustration on the Field

During the third day of the first Test match against England in Leeds, Indian wicketkeeper Rishabh Pant expressed his frustration towards the umpire by throwing the ball after a heated exchange. This incident has quickly gained traction on social media, with footage showing Pant initially conversing with the umpire before tossing the ball onto the ground. There are speculations that Pant may face a fine for his actions.




In the first session of play on the third day, Pant, who serves as the vice-captain, requested umpire Paul Reiffel to change the ball, but his request was denied. Following this, Pant visibly upset, threw the ball onto the field. The video captures Pant appealing for a ball change, only for the umpire to dismiss it, suggesting it might be changed later. After the umpire's refusal, Pant's frustration led him to discard the ball.




Throughout the first session, Indian players frequently debated with the on-field umpires regarding the condition of the ball. Jasprit Bumrah was also seen discussing the matter with the umpire in the footage. As the game approached the 60-over mark on the third day, Pant was observed requesting Reiffel to use a gauge to check the ball's size.




Reiffel utilized the gauge, and the ball passed the inspection without issue, leading him to reject Pant's request. Pant then urged the umpire to recheck the ball, but Reiffel remained firm in his decision. A couple of overs later, captain Shubman Gill made another attempt to request a ball change from the umpire, which was also denied.
